Former Glee star Charice Pempengco is talking about gender and sexuality. The Filipina singer and past Glee actor plans on answering questions to do with her sexuality and gender in this coming Sunday’s Oprah: Where Are They Now episode.
It was only in recent times, that rumors had started which said the pop star, who revealed herself to be a lesbian in 2013, could be working on changing into a male. When Oprah asked Pempengco if the gossip was correct, Charice made clear that she was not exactly changing herself into to a male-male. However, she added that her soul was like a male. She stated that she had no plans to go all the way through where she altered everything on her body. Instead, she just wants to keep her hair a short length and wear guys clothes.
The vocalist, who performed in Glee during its second season as a foreign exchange student and whom Oprah once said was the most talented girl on Earth, also talked about being mixed up by her own sexuality when she was a very young child. She explained that when she was around age five, she knew something was different because she looked at a girl and felt weird. She said she had no idea what it was. However, after she turned 10 years old, she was able to understand her personal feelings and told herself that she was gay. She stated that she had finally figured out what was going on with her.
Pempengco has also been a sensation on YouTube and got personal with Oprah on her show when she talked about her sexuality and gender. Due to the actress so quickly changing her appearance after coming out, that is what caused many people to wonder if she had decided to go through gender transformation assignment?
The last time Charice sat down with Winfrey was in 2008. At that time, she was a young teen and spoke with the talk show giant on The Oprah Winfrey Show, reported several different news media sources. The singer’s look has changed dramatically since then, and she is going to talk about that radical change.
When Winfrey made her statement about Pempengco being so talented, Charice’s career immediately shot through the roof with a best selling album. However, her personal life started to fall apart. She became alienated from her parents, and in 2011 her father was stabbed to death. She then received a host of Internet criticism in 2012 when she began to change her appearance.
In 2013, Pempengco decided to come out to fans who were allegedly shocked about her admission. This is probably because Charice started her career with having more of a “normal” look. She dressed in a feminine way and had long hair, yet she feels her soul is male. Because of that her appearance has changed to look more masculine. She says she finally feels comfortable with the way she looks and dresses. She stated that cutting her hair and donning guy clothes would be the only things she would do.
